She went to the kitchen to make sandwiches for the next day lunch, washed the popcorn bowls, took meat out of the freezer for supper the following evening, checked the cereal box levels, filled the sugar container, put spoons and bowls on the table and got the coffee pot ready for the next day breakfast.

She entered kids’ room, stopped by the desk, wrote a note to the teacher, and pulled a text book out from hiding under the chair. Then she turned off their bedside lamps and radios, kissed the sleeping kids good night, and had a brief conversation in a low voice with the one up still doing homework. "M" is for the million things you gave me, "O" means only that you’re growing old, "T" is for the tears you shed to save me, "H" is for your heart of purest gold, "E" is for your eyes, with the love-light shining, "R" means right, and right you'll always be, Put them all together, they spell "MOTHER", A word that means the world to me.
